Juliusz Machulski

Juliusz Machulski (born March 10, 1955 in Olsztyn ) is a Polish film director, screenwriter and film producer.

Life

Machulski was born the son of the well-known Polish actor Jan Machulski . He graduated from the Łódź Film School . He made his first feature film in 1981. His comedies are very popular in Poland and were big box office hits in Poland in the 1990s. Machulski received several awards at the Polish Film Festival Gdynia between 1981 and 2004 . In 1999 he also produced Krzysztof Krauze's thriller Schuld , which was awarded the Polish Film Prize for best cinema production in 2000.

In 1988 he co-founded the independent production company Zebra in Warsaw, for which he still works today and which produced some notable films in the post-reunification period.
